Does petunia prefer shade or sun?

Petunia is not easy to grow. It is not cold-resistant, not waterlogged, and prefers a warm, sunny growing environment. Petunia is not cold-resistant. If the temperature exceeds the temperature at which it grows, it will stop growing. In addition, water management must also be thoughtful. Too much drought or too much waterlogging is not good.

Does petunia like the sun?

Petunia is a light-loving plant. During maintenance, it should be placed in a place with good light, exposed to the sun more, and given light all day. Direct light is best, but scattered light is also fine.

Petunias can be exposed to the sun in the summer and are not afraid of exposure to the sun, but if the temperature is too high, its leaves will be burned by the sun and cause yellow leaves and other phenomena. At this time, they should be transplanted indoors or shaded by about 30%.

Is petunia shade tolerant?

Petunia can tolerate partial shade and can be planted in a cool environment for a short period of time. If it is planted in a cool environment for a long time, it will not only fail to bloom, but the leaves will also become soft and the branches and leaves will grow wildly.

Petunia growing environment

Petunia is not very picky about the soil. It is best to choose loose, fertile, well-drained slightly acidic sandy soil. The suitable growth temperature for petunia is 13-18℃. In winter, the temperature should be controlled at 4-10℃. If the temperature is too low, it will stop growing.

Petunia likes dry conditions, so it is necessary to water it in moderation, not too much or too little. Generally, it is necessary to maintain sufficient moisture when the temperature is high in summer and water it in time, but make sure that there is no water accumulation in the potting soil. When it rains a lot, drainage measures must be taken to prevent water accumulation and root rot. If there is too much rain during the flowering period, the flower color will become dull.
